About This Item
First edition paperback, 316 pages, with index. An Adams Media production. This copy is good, with firm binding, some minor rubbing to cover edges, and minor corner bumping. A few scuff marks and shelf wear, greying of page edges. Has small inscription to a previous owner on title page. Decipher your dreams, and deeply look into their meanings. This book guides you how.
